State Street Corporation, established in 1792 and headquartered in Boston, Massachusetts, is one of the oldest financial institutions in the United States and a major player in the global asset management and custody banking sectors. Primarily known for its custodial services, it safeguards assets for institutional investors, managing trillions of dollars through its State Street Global Advisors (SSGA) division, which is renowned for launching the first U.S. exchange-traded fund (ETF), the SPDR S&P 500 ETF (SPY), in 1993. The company provides a range of services including investment management, research, trading, and data analytics, catering mostly to institutional clients like pension funds, endowments, and mutual funds. With a focus on financial infrastructure and innovation, State Street has positioned itself as a key backbone in the global investment ecosystem.

State Street's Q3 2021 Portfolio in Review

As of Q3 2021, State Street held 4,773 positions worth $1.89T, down 0.28% from $1.9T the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 21% of the portfolio.

State Street's Q3 2021 filing shows 298 new, 2,370 increased, 1,521 reduced and 88 closed positions. Its largest new stake was GXO Logistics: 2,520,396 shares worth $198M. The largest sale was Alexion Pharmaceuticals, an estimated $1.84B.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 22% of assets, up from 22% a quarter earlier, followed by Financials and Healthcare.
